Your role

Are you passionate about directly impacting the business by utilizing analytical and machine learning skills? Do you want to play a key role in mining large datasets, build advanced statistical models to generate meaningful and actionable insights, improve decision making, optimize the business process, and help address business problems?

We are looking for a NLP Data Scientist:

Contribute to end-to-end model development and deployment, adhering to best practices for software engineering and reproducible research
Develop and maintain LLM evaluation tooling to track model performance, reliability and consistency across a variety of metrics throughout the development and deployment lifecycle
Communicate techn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ences

Your team

You will be part of the Data Science team in the Data Analytics Foundational Platform Team (DAFP), WMA. Our Data Science team is at the heart of DAFP's function to manage and support data science efforts across different business areas. Our team is global based in US, Poland, and China.

Your expertise

Bachelor's degree or higher in Machine Learning, Computer Science, Computational Linguistics or other relevant technical field
Extensive practical experience with techniques from natural language processing, machine learning, deep learning, and prompt engineering
Demonstrated proficiency in Python, especially in the following frameworks and libraries: PyTorch, transformers, LangChain, openai, spaCy
Experience developing information retrieval and search solutions
Hands-on experience working with Large Language Model APIs like Azure OpenAI, Anthropic etc.
Extensive practical experience with version control and software engineering best practices
Experience working with cloud ecosystems like Azure, AWS, Google Cloud Platform, Databricks etc.
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to present complex ideas to both technical and non-technical audiences.
